The journey from Kingsbridge to Nottingham covers approximately 280 miles. By train, you travel from Totnes to London Paddington, transfer to St Pancras International, and take the EMR service to Nottingham. By car, the route follows the A38, M5, M42, and M1. This trip connects the rural South West to the historic city of Nottingham. Expect a full day of travel.
